Scope and Contents
Scope and Contents
Ca. 200 personal letters and notes to Ultra Violet from John Graham, Ray Johnson, and John Chamberlain; a few photographs of Graham and Johnson; a few sketches by each of the three artists; and miscellaneous clippings, magazine articles, and exhibition announcements.
Biographical / Historical
Biographical / Historical
Actress; New York, N.Y. Born Isabelle Collin DuFresne.
